AR is actually home to over 2,000 lakes that each offer something special and unique. Some are known for their sandy shoreline while others are known for their pristine landscape. Lake Ouachita is known for having the clearest water.

Arkansas' largest lake, Ouachita offers 40,000 acres of clear, clean water surrounded by the scenic Ouachita National Forest. It is located out in western Arkansas about an hour and a half outside of Little Rock.

Completed in the year 1953, the lake was originally used to control floods and provide electricity. Today, it is used primarily for recreational activities.

Scuba diving is another popular activity here. Bream, crappie, catfish, striped bass, and largemouth bass can all be seen here.

Ouachita is deepest near the dam at around 200 feet. In the summer months, the water is a warm 70 degrees. Its pristine waters are largely undeveloped making them clean and clear most of the time.
